Barrier Islands council nominates three candidates for Pinellas County TDC slot

Summary

The council selected a three‑person slate to recommend to the Pinellas County Commission for the Tourist Development Council slot, naming Scott Tate first and John Doctor second; the list will be submitted to Commissioner Eggers.

Mayor Dave Geddes opened the floor for nominations to fill the Barrier Islands' upcoming vacancy on the Pinellas County Tourist Development Council. Councilors nominated multiple candidates and then selected a three‑person list to forward to the county commission: Mayor Scott Tate was moved and approved as the first choice; John Doctor was nominated as the second choice; Michael Howard and Bruce (last name not specified) were also nominated during the discussion.

Geddes said the usual practice is to submit three nominees and allow the county commission to make the appointment; he asked staff to forward the council's recommendations to Commissioner David Eggers. The council approved the slate by voice vote.
